Living with Type 2 Diabetes Program
American Diabetes Association (ADA)
The Living with Type 2 Diabetes Program in Coffeyville, KS, is dedicated to supporting individuals recently diagnosed with type 2 diabetes. This comprehensive, free program spans 12 months and is designed to empower participants through gradual learning about diabetes management. Offered in both English and Spanish, the program includes six informative e-booklets tailored to address the needs of those navigating their new diagnosis, alongside a monthly e-newsletter packed with seasonal tips and local resources. Participants can also engage in community events and have the opportunity to connect with ADA experts during the monthly 'Ask the Experts' Q&A series, where they can ask questions, explore the link between diabetes and heart health, and enjoy giveaways designed to enhance their well-being. Farm & Food Systems Fellowship
Allegheny Mountain Institute (AMI)
The Farm & Food Systems Fellowship in Coffeyville, KS is dedicated to cultivating the next generation of advocates and educators for a just food system that prioritizes social, environmental, and economic equity. Our fellowship program offers hands-on, organic food system education without tuition fees, ensuring accessibility for all passionate individuals. Over a transformative six-month period at our Allegheny Farm Campus, selected Fellows engage in experiential learning while actively participating in initiatives such as growing and distributing diverse crops, mentoring future leaders, and integrating food and ecological literacy into community activities. Through collaborations with local non-profits during the Community Action Year, our Fellows apply their training to support local food systems, including farmers markets and community gardens, ultimately working to enhance access to nutritious food for all. Applications are accepted until March each year, with experiences typically running from May to October.

One-On-One Nutrition Consultations
Leukemia and Lymphoma Society (LLS)
In Coffeyville, KS, One-On-One Nutrition Consultations provides vital support for patients and caregivers navigating the complexities of cancer care. Through personalized, free consultations with registered dietitians, we empower individuals with essential nutrition education tailored to their unique needs. Our services include actionable strategies to enhance nutrition and manage treatment side effects, practical meal planning advice, and guidance on how to effectively support loved ones during their cancer journey. Clients can also receive insights on critical questions to ask their healthcare teams and discover additional nutrition resources available locally and online. Each consultation typically lasts around 30 minutes, ensuring a focused and meaningful exchange to promote well-being during challenging times.
